Job Description
Position Overview Provides senior-level technical support for security testing services across infrastructure, systems, and applications. This role is responsible for strengthening cloud security posture through automation, tooling, and cross-functional collaboration. Core Responsibilities Develop and maintain CSPM tooling, automation pipelines, and integrations to support vulnerability identification, prioritization, and remediation across cloud environments Engineer and operationalize cloud security posture controls, including preventative policies, build enforcement rules, and automated remediation workflows Build and maintain integrations between security platforms and enterprise systems (e.g., CI/CD pipelines, reporting tools) to enable self-service capabilities and streamline exception management Configure and tune cloud security policies to ensure accurate and reliable assessment outcomes Analyze vulnerability and misconfiguration data to enhance risk scoring by incorporating exploit intelligence, environmental context, and threat signals Partner with Platform Engineering, DevOps, SRE, and application teams to implement shift-left security practices and drive adoption of security tooling Contribute to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) reviews, ensuring security controls are embedded, version-controlled, and enforced at deployment Support special projects, including AI-assisted security tooling initiatives Preferred Qualifications Proficiency in at least one programming language (e.g., Python, Go, JavaScript/TypeScript, Ruby) Hands-on experience with a major cloud platform (AWS, Azure, or GCP) Experience with Infrastructure-as-Code (e.g., Terraform, CloudFormation) Familiarity with CSPM or cloud security tooling Understanding of API design, systems integration, and event-driven architectures Qualifications Minimum of 3+ years of experience in cloud security, vulnerability management, or security engineering Bachelor's degree in a related field or equivalent combination of education and experience Special Factors Sponsorship Vanguard is not offering visa sponsorship for this position.
